Output 58e85ab8153dd31c27b4566fda81fcaf163e0f1b403cd7bfe0f788e7a1ca92d5:3

value
125356473
script pubkey
OP_0 OP_PUSHBYTES_32 d4025d0244dfad27920a28838e986387f4a92ee8900ebcb03890f64c995348b1
address
bc1q6sp96qjym7kj0ys29zpcaxrrsl62jthgjq8tevpcjrmyex2nfzcshlcpcg
transaction
58e85ab8153dd31c27b4566fda81fcaf163e0f1b403cd7bfe0f788e7a1ca92d5